increases healing rate Crusader's Ring : +1 Strength Frivlar's Ring : +1 Health Ring of Agility : +1 Dexterity Sage's Ring : +1 Intelligence POTIONS: Discipline Elixer : +1 Willpower Elixir of Fortitude : +1 Health Elixir of Grace : +1 Dexterity Elixir of Might : +1 Strength Enlightenment Elixir : +1 Intelligence Herbal Remedy : Adds 6 hp to total (permanent) Mana : Restores mana to full WANDS: Lightning Rod : Casts lightning bolt spell Radiant Sceptre : Casts banish spell Wand of Ashes : Casts fireball spell Wand of Magic : Restores mana Wand of Undoing : Casts dispel spell Wand of Whispers : Casts charm spell Wilhelms Wand : Casts mana bolt BOOKS: A Master Halberdier : +50 Polearm skill Annals of a Thief : +25 Pick Pocket / +25 Lock Picking Archer's Handbook : +50 Bow skill Disintegrate Spellbook : +10 Cast spell skill OR learn disintegrate spell Ice Missle Spellbook : +10 Cast spell skill OR learn ice missle spell Powder and Shot : +50 Firearms skill The Duelists Craft : +50 Fencing skill The Hammer Stroke : +50 Axe/mace skill The Hunter's Track : +50 Stealth skill The Physical Adept : +25 Martial arts / +25 Acrobat Theurgic Principals : +50 Cast spells skill Waer's Bestiary : +50 Xenology skill Whirlwind Spellbook : +10 Cast spell skill OR learn whirlwind spell Misc Magic: Fairy Dust Pouch : Casts sleep spell Roscoe's Belt : +20 to fencing skill Talon of Anarch : Casts maelstrom spell Tear of the Beast : Casts charm spell --------------------------------------------------------------------------- SECTION 4 - HELPFUL HINTS When creating characters, and when going up levels, SPECIALIZE! Well-rounded characters are less effective in this game. Set up each character with a different non-combat skill. Build up one character's merchant skill early in the game - you will get a much better price early in the game, when it really counts. In shops, click on buy and on identify to check out stats for items the shop has for sale (for free!). The identify option in shops will not usually give any info on items that adjust a character's primary statistics. Try equipping these items and watching to see if any numbers change ... Start every character with at least a few points in the cast spells skill, and have them learn the heal spell first. They will begin accumulating mana points from the start of the game, and you will have lots of points to burn on heal spells throughout the game. Characters with the axe/mace skill, using magical warhammers, have a slight edge in critical blows/damage vs swords late in the game. When creating characters, give all character types a high dex - this is THE essential stat for upgrading weapons skills when going up levels. There are a number of actions in the game that reward the characters with experience points. Characters do not go up levels for these XP until after the next battle. Watch for this. Several times in the game, an object needs to be touched by an item in inventory. Do this by going to the character's inventory, clicking on the item (making it the mouse pointer), clicking on exit to return to the game screen, then clicking on the object that needs to be touched. 'Run and jump' is best done using the keyboard movement and jumping keys, and both hands. Use the numeric keypad 8 to run forward, and the letter 'j' to jump when the takeoff point is reached. Some of the switches and levers in the game are touchy about where the mouse pointer is located when trying to activate them. Try moving the mouse pointer to different positions on the switch/button, or moving to get a different angle on them. Most switches and buttons can be activated from several feet away. Almost every object found in the game has a use, but not all of them are necessary for completing the game. There are several sideline quests and puzzles that do not need to be solved to complete the main quest. Keyboard Commands not in the Manual: Page Up / Page Down (not num. keypad 9/3) - Look up / Look down Arrow Up / Arrow Down (not num. keypad 8/2) - Scroll up/down through text on screen (scrolls, signs, books, etc) --------------------------------------------------------------------------- SECTION 5 - LEVELS LIST 1. Citadel roof --------------------------------------------------------------------------- SECTION 6 - KNOWN PROBLEMS The original CD version of Thunderscape was released with some "Unstable Code" (their words, not mine). This can create some strange problems throughout the game. Corrupted level data in memory - there are a number of symptoms for this problem. If one or more of these show up, or if a problem is suspected, the only solution is as follows: - Retreat to the previous level and save game in slot 1, or identify a slot with a savegame on the prevous level. - Exit the game - In the thunderscape directory, there will be sub-directories named SAVE0, SAVE1, SAVE2, and SAVE3. These correspond to slots 1 thru 4 respectively. - Delete the highest-numbered LEVELxx.DAT file in the sub-directory containing the savegame you will be restoring. This will force the game to re-initialize the corrupted level. - Re-start the game, and load the game from the slot you deleted the corrupted level from. This means restarting the affected level from the beginning, but this is probably better than starting the game over from the start. Here is a list of the possible symptoms: - Missing keys/objects/buttons/switches etc that are supposed to be there. - Music or sound effects that 'echo' and repeat without stopping. - Doors that won't open, platforms that won't move, switches and buttons that won't work, any of which do work under normal circumstances. This is hard to identify, because many of these don't work at times as a normal part of the game. - Switches or buttons that have disappeared, or are now placed in 'impossible' places, such as in midair. Possible causes for this problem are as follows: - Moving through many different levels in one playing session. (I can re-create this problem moving through more than 5 different levels in any session). - Reloading a savegame while the game is actively doing something (like squishing the characters). - Having the party die, then reloading a savegame. If something strange happens, exit the game and restart from the last savegame. If the game is saved after something funny happens, that saved level may be 'corrupt', and might not be fully playable. Game exits to dos/windows with the message 'RAN OUT OF RENDER POSTS'. This is caused by having too many items of inventory dropped onto one spot. This can happen if the characters drop many different items in one place, either by 'cleaning out inventory', or by 'dropping' an NPC with lots of inventory and replacing it with another one. The solution is to drop only a few items in any one spot, or to drop only items of the same type on the same spot (ie all scrolls, all potions, all armor etc). For the NPC, clean out the NPC's inventory before replacing it with another NPC. Running the game on a HD that requires Ontrack's Disk Manager for access. There seems to be some sort of interface or disk management conflict here. The game is playable, but the saved games will be written out all over the place on the disk surface (only onto unused sectors- there is NO disk corruption problem!). This fragments the data on the HD, and gets worse each time a game is saved. If not handled properly, the game will eventually crash during a save or restore with the error message 'cannot find disk sector', and hang. The solution to this problem is to 'defragment' the hard drive on a frequent basis (I needed to do this after every 4 to 5 saves), using the defrag utility in DOS, Norton Utilities, PC tools, or any of a number of other disk management systems available. If you have crashed, you will most likely have 'lost' clusters on your HD. Run any decent disk utility to fix the problem (DOS 'chkdsk /F' and scandisk both work fine). --------------------------------------------------------------------------- SECTION 7 - MISC SHOP LOCATIONS: 1 - Finea's, Valley floor, near starting point 2 - Gnash's, Lower Karegh-Konan, after caverns, before Lord of the Worms 3 - ??? NPC CHARACTERS: Theros the Ferran St 18 Dx 12 In 11 Wi 14 He 19 Hp 59 Mp 33 Lv 5 Swo 62 Axe 45 Bow 21 Shl 28 Merc 12 Xen 15 Meet on the starting dock - first encounter (L1) Leaves when L4 complete (capstan level) Bert the Troll St 30 Dx 7 In 5 Wi 16 He 21 Hp 64 Mp 17 Lv 5 Axe 71 M/A 43 Xen 11 Meet on the bridge, in the valley (L1) Selene the Elf St 13 Dx 17 In 19 Wi 9 He 14 Hp 96 Mp 123 Lv 12 M/A 73 Knf 160 Ste 100 Secr 19 Xen 24 Cast 117 Meet in secret room on L5 (top level of keep tower) Leaves when L5 complete Prototype 17 Golem St 26 Dx 7 In 3 Wi 40 He 26 Hp 210 Mp 0 Lv 15 Axe 180 Built on L7 (Golem level) Lord Drazul-Rapacian St 20 Dx 16 In 14 Wi 17 He 20 Hp 301 Mp 0 Lv 20 Swo 120 Axe 90 Shi 90 Pol 325 Ste 45 Secr 60 Merc 75 Sacred mines, L10, near bloody trail Arghaan the Dwarf St 20 Dx 13 In 14 Wi 16 He 22 Hp 289 Mp 0 Lv 20 Swo 100 Axe 350 Gun 100 Secr 90 Merc 35 Ashak the Jurak St 21 Dx 15 In 14 Wi 18 He 19 Hp 506 Mp 385 Lv 35 Swo 286 Axe 585 Shi 189 M/A 291 Cast 367 ERRATA: The manual (P6) states that "NPCs cannot be given items by the characters, or share equipment". For NPCs who have joined the party, this is not true. "When NPCs are replaced, they take all their items in inventory with them." This is also not true. All of the items they carried are dropped into a pile on the floor. KNOWN 'LEGAL' CHEATS: Free HP. After a character gains a level, and before performing any other actions, go into the character's inventory, and move an item. The game will give out another increment to the character's HP. Free XP. Use ranged weapons to kill a monster (at least two bows are required). If arrows are sent in a steady stream and hit the dying monster, the monster is 'killed' again and again, and the characters are credited with the XP for the extra 'kills'. Push one character's merchant skills over 100. (Say, 150 or 200). This allows the character to sell items in shops for more than the listed cost! With some quick buying and selling, the characters should be able to outfit themselves with the best items in the shop, and have lots of cash available for identifying items.
